### Exactly what is Payload in Drones?

The **payload of a drone** is the total pounds of all products and cargo it carries, excluding the drone’s personal pounds. One example is, if a drone’s highest takeoff weight (MTOW) is twenty kg and theUas Payload drone alone weighs 12 kg, the payload ability is eight kg. Payload capability instantly impacts what duties a drone can accomplish, from aerial pictures to industrial inspections and offer shipping and delivery[one][two].

### UAV Payload Varieties

Payloads is usually broadly categorized by their purpose and mounting fashion:

- **Cameras:** The most typical payload, such as RGB, thermal, infrared, and multispectral cameras, employed for images, surveillance, mapping, and inspections[1][2][five].
- **Sensors:** Environmental sensors measuring temperature, humidity, fuel ranges, or collision avoidance sensors for safer flight[2][seven].
- **Supply Techniques:** Cargo compartments or bins designed to transport products, medical supplies, or unexpected emergency machines[one][7].
- **Specialized Products:** LiDAR scanners, magnetometers, radiation sensors, and various scientific instruments for Superior facts selection[5][7].

### Weighty Payload Drones and Their Applications

**Heavy payload drones** are designed with strong frames and highly effective engines to hold huge weights, usually exceeding 25 kg. These drones involve larger sized batteries to maintain flight endurance and therefore are Employed in development, logistics, and disaster relief, where by carrying significant products or supplies is significant[two][6].
